Michael_Larsen It does, I have just tested a Dropbox to Sharepoint migration and had the same question in mind.
Things tested:
1) Created the migration and completed the migration to SPS
2) Made changes on the source,I.e created a new folder and changed file contents etc
3) Rerun the Migration and it migrated newer contents only.
It would be nice If MS makes it clear otherwise.It just an trial and error.
